International Conference
Islamic Economics: An Institutional Economic Perspective
Organized by:
Islamic Society of Institutional Economics (ISIE)
June, 2009, Islamabad, Pakistan
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
The first issue of the Journal of Islamic Society of Institutional Economics (JOISIE) will be expected appear in the shape of proceedings of the conference to be held in June 2009.
Focus for the Conference
- Alternate Paradigm for Economic Thoughts & Economic orthodoxy
- Discipline of Islamic Economics between Neo Classical and Institutional Schools
- Developing Economies in the light of Institutional Reforms
- Institutional Structure Muslim Economies
- Institutional Reforms & Economic Performance
- Economic Institution and Poverty

Notes for Contributors
All articles must be in English. They may be submitted in electronic format only to isie@i-sie.org . MSWord, and pdf files are acceptable.
There must be no indication of the personal identity or institution of any author of the article within the article itself, or in the 'properties' of the electronic file. Normally, articles (including footnotes and references) must be no longer than 9,000 words. In special cases, such as an extended review article, this limit may be extended to 12,000 words.
